Say, our alarms went off tonight when we saw a roughly tenfold spike in BGP prefix announcement and withdrawal rates at RIPE's rrc00 and rrc03 collection points in Amsterdam. The trouble started around 20:00 GMT, hit its peak by about 21:00 GMT, and has trailed off slowly since then. Looking at the worst-behaved prefixes and AS paths led me to put in a call to the tech support center of an unnamed Major Provider, who confirmed that there had been a major BGP event but would provide no specifics. So, what's going on out there in the NOCs tonight? Inquiring minds want to know. --jim
